Output ff7d124b1aee93b836d3224be73d71a714a4b9ce43ddd9bf7c0a28a8f577901d:2

value
23973984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50c39aaaef942980530da4e1252c8bdbcca484a OP_EQUAL
address
3Keugm44yCR8SRgHjnZzt4Wx76fx8SEs3t
transaction
ff7d124b1aee93b836d3224be73d71a714a4b9ce43ddd9bf7c0a28a8f577901d
spent
true